Transaction 569957a7a295530e6ed3c23952d22fdbebaeb955c5c1348c2f1a4e5533e83c31

1 Input
1 Outputs
  • 569957a7a295530e6ed3c23952d22fdbebaeb955c5c1348c2f1a4e5533e83c31:0
  • value  382839
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G